All offences Β·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Hulse Avenue area has the 4th lowest crime rate of 67 local areas in Eastbury , and the 13th lowest crime rate of 521 local areas in Barking and Dagenham .
This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Hulse Avenue (IG11 9UN) in the last 12 months was 14.6 per 1,000 residents and was 82.7% lower than the Eastbury average (84.2 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this areaβs most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 6 offences recorded. The least common crime was Possession of weapons with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Possession of weapons 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Vehicle crime ( -50.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 7 (β 12.7 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 16.7%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 7.3%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Hulse Avenue (IG11 9UN),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Aldersey Gardens, where police recorded 61 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Strathfield Gardens (26 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
